it’s a 2018 malibu... This car was in a wreck and declared a total loss. That’s the connector for a seatbelt pre-tensioner. Someone told this customer that they replaced all of the airbags and seatbelts and charged them for parts and labor. All four front seatbelt retractor pre-tensioners and anchor pre-tensioners had resistors installed to trick the airbag module into thinking there is nothing wrong, thus making the warning light turn off.
